u/VoiceDry5160 NON-US IMG 10d ago

Ur UWorld percentage doesn’t mean anything

The more u make mistakes the more u learn, what matters is the quality of ur sessions and information retention

I finished uwolrd with ~65% corrects and my last 2 nbmes where 270 - 264.

My only advice is random wise-timed, specially if u are a graduate, and never sleep on any principle or disease

If uworld has a question about it , that means it appeared in a cms or nbme forms so it’s important
